CONSIDERATIONS TO KNOW ABOUT MASKAPAITOTO

Considerations To Know About maskapaitoto

Considerations To Know About maskapaitoto

Blog Article

the key entity is the Maskito class, and that is initialized with two arguments. the initial is actually a reference to a native or element, and the next argument would be the mask configuration.

amid our elements There are many of masked textual content fields: for mobile phone, for dates, for time, and even a complex component to enter bank card. I have pointed out only the preferred elements, our UI Kit consists of noticeably much more samples of masked textual content fields.

Enable’s complicate the undertaking. Some end users commonly use a comma being a decimal separator, while some may argue that the point is the greater commonly utilized separator.

The preprocessor allows the developer to include custom made worth mutations prior to the mask commences its do the job. All things considered preprocessors have completed their perform, The brand new value is passed to the mask.

You choose which Software is best for your new case. Similarly with masking libraries — there are numerous well known libraries, but regretably not all of these were correctly suited for our jobs.

once the class is initialized, native celebration listeners are enabled to control all consumer interaction with text bins.

Let’s Have a very think about the configuration on the mask. within the code block above it is actually an item that implements the MaskitoOptions interface and is also handed as the second argument to the Maskito course.

It can be a basic regular expression, or it can be an variety of mini-normal expressions. The last possibility is a lot more complex, wanted for masks with a hard and fast number of people.

Maskito is a set of libraries. the principle 1 @maskito/core is a lightweight 3kb deal without any exterior dependencies. The core library is sufficient to mask the input in an easy vanilla javascript application.

it is necessary to make a distinction involving the terms “masking” and “validation”. Yes, the two processes have an analogous intent. on the other hand, masking assists the person to enter a sound worth, and validation only checks if the final value is appropriate (it only returns a boolean respond to Consequently).

the very first argument of your postprocessor is the condition of the component: the new worth of the text discipline and The brand new positions in the text assortment (In the end validations and calibrations of the mask).

Permit’s make one very last improvement to our mask for entering quantities and include the next conduct: if the user tries to insert a selection with a great deal of primary zeros at the start of your integer portion, then discard the extra ones. For example, if a user enters the string 000.42, the value of the textual content area need to turn out to be 0.42.

The conditions “mask”, “enter or textual content subject masking”, as well as other similar words are described again and again in the post. Allow’s focus on the that means of this expression for the online.

we're content to announce that check here we have produced our undertaking Maskito to open up resource. the very first secure key Variation has become accessible. Maskito is a set of libraries to simplify the entire process of masking textual content fields that has a convenient and flexible community API.

Our new job ought to include quite a few libraries and the most crucial a person ought to be framework impartial. For popular Website frameworks, we should always publish optional small deals.

Block person reduce this consumer from interacting with the repositories and sending you notifications. find out more about blocking consumers. it's essential to be logged in to dam end users. incorporate an optional note:

But challenges come about when you have to produce a a lot more elaborate solution with its own special habits. The libraries didn’t present the identical versatile community API as it absolutely was inside our preceding library text-mask.

Report this page